  1. itch

    • IPA[iCH]


    • n.
      an uncomfortable sensation on the skin that causes a desire to scratch.;a skin disease or condition of which itching is a symptom.
    • v.
      be the site of or cause an itch;(of a person) experience an itch
    • verb: itch, 3rd person present: itches, gerund or present participle: itching, past tense: itched, past participle: itched

    • noun: itch, plural noun: itches

    • 釋義